cantguardjake wrote: Tue Dec 29, 2020 2:29 pm Why would the Jags spend any decent pick or cash on a running back when they already have one who is both good and cheap? They have a million holes in the roster that need filling, running back isn’t one of them.

Probably the same people who kept mocking Swift to the Dolphins last year even after they went and signed Howard for peanuts.

It’s the ideal situation for the Jags, a tonne of picks a tonne of cap and none of it needs to be spent on a running back.

This. The Jags are one year behind the Dolphins as far as making the playoffs. I expect the Dolphins to add a RB through the draft this year. Now the Dolphins get a RB on the cheap for 4 years. I would expect the Jags to go with Robinson next year and maybe add one in 2022 if Robinson has a down year. Then the Jags have a cheap RB for 4 years, or they can lean on Robinson for 2 more.

Sold JRob and 1:12 for Golladay and Rojo earlier this month.

Wasn't 100% sure on it but I felt like I had the chance to turn a free waiver pickup into a proven asset like Golladay and pickup Jones who I think has a shot to come close to his totals as replacement.

If you have a chance to sell an undrafted rookie on the worst team in the league before the draft for top dollar I think you pull the trigger.

Some dynasty sites right now have JRob ranked over guys like Chubb, Lamb and Gibson. Not anymore
